National Biodiesel Board sees Congress including biodiesel in tax extenders bill

November 16, 2015 |

In Washington, the National Biodiesel Board believes Congress may be of a mind to approve at least two-years worth of tax extenders legislation that would include a biodiesel producer tax incentive. The blenders credit would be eliminated as it is seen to promote foreign production rather than domestic. There is hope for a longer-term bill, however, thanks to the Senate finance committee chairman who is looking to a longer time horizon for the tax extenders legislation.
